Python中使用round函数计算数据集中某列占比

本篇介绍如何使用Python中的round函数计算数据集中某列的占比,并保留指定位数的小数。

**代码示例:**pythonround(100 * d['stroke'].sum() / len(d['stroke']), 2)

代码解析:

  • d:表示一个数据集,可以是DataFrame或Series类型。* d['stroke']:从数据集中选择名为'stroke'的列。* d['stroke'].sum():计算'stroke'列中所有元素的总和。* len(d['stroke']):计算'stroke'列的长度,即元素个数。* 100 * d['stroke'].sum() / len(d['stroke']):计算'stroke'列中所有元素总和占整个列长度的百分比。* round(..., 2):使用round函数将计算结果保留两位小数。

总结:

这行代码的作用是计算数据集中'stroke'列的总和占整个列长度的百分比,并将结果保留两位小数。该方法可以应用于计算数据集中任何数值列的占比,只需要将代码中的列名替换即可。

Python中使用round函数计算数据集中某列占比

原文地址: https://www.cveoy.top/t/topic/RCt 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录